Bu makalede, MySQL veritabanı oluşturma işleminin adımlarını öğrenin Yükleme ve gereksinimleriyle başlayan makalede, MySQL sunucusuna bağlanma ve sunucu seçenekleri hakkında bilgi edinin Son olarak, adım adım veritabanı oluşturma işlemiyle devam edin MySQL, kullanımı kolay bir veritabanı yönetim sistemidir ve web siteleri, bloglar ve uygulamalar için temel bir gereksinimdir Yerel bağlantı, SSH ve GUI gibi farklı yöntemlerle MySQL sunucusuna bağlanabilirsiniz Bu adımları takip ederek MySQL kullanarak veritabanınızı oluşturabilir ve yönetebilirsiniz

Veritabanı oluşturma işlemi herhangi bir web sitesinin, blogun veya uygulamanın temelini oluşturur. Bu nedenle, doğru bir şekilde yapılması çok önemlidir. MySQL, en yaygın kullanılan veritabanı yönetim sistemlerinden biridir ve kullanıcı dostu arayüzü sayesinde veritabanı oluşturma işlemini kolaylaştırır.
Bu makalede, MySQL veritabanı oluşturma işleminin adımlarını öğreneceksiniz. İlk adım olarak, MySQL yükleme adımlarını ve gereksinimlerini inceleyeceğiz. Ardından, MySQL sunucusuna nasıl bağlanılacağına ve sunucu seçeneklerine bakacağız. Son olarak, veritabanı oluşturma adımlarını ele alacağız.
Adım 1: MySQL Yükleme
MySQL veritabanı oluşturmak istediğinizde öncelikle MySQL'i sisteminize yüklemelisiniz. Bu nedenle ilk adım, MySQL'in indirilmesi ve yüklenmesidir.
MySQL yükleme işlemi için bilgisayarınızın gereksinimleri, işletim sisteminiz ve kullanılacak MySQL sürümü önemlidir. Örneğin, Windows platformu için MySQL'in 7.0.16 sürümü kullanılabilirken, Linux için 8.0.12 sürümü gerekebilir.
Yükleme işleminin sonrasında, MySQL için bir kullanıcı hesabı oluşturmanız önerilir. Bu hesap ile MySQL sunucusuna erişim sağlayabilirsiniz.
Ayrıca, MySQL'in kurulum aşamasında, PHPMyAdmin gibi konsol uygulamalarının da kurulumunu yapabilirsiniz. Bu, MySQL veritabanı işlemlerini daha fazla kolaylaştıracaktır.
Yükleme işleminin tamamlanmasının ardından, MySQL sunucusu hizmetini başlatmanız gerekir. Bu sayede MySQL sunucusuna bağlanabilir ve veritabanı işlemlerinizi gerçekleştirebilirsiniz. Bu adımların tamamlanmasının sonrasında, veritabanı oluşturma adımlarına doğru ilerleyebilirsiniz.
Adım 2: MySQL Sunucusuna Bağlanma
MySQL veritabanı oluşturmak için ilk olarak MySQL sunucusuna bağlanmanız gerekiyor. Bunun için, öncelikle bir MySQL sunucusu yüklemeniz ve bu sunucuya bağlanmak için gereken bilgileri edinmeniz gerekiyor.
MySQL sunucusuna bağlanmak için birkaç farklı yöntem mevcuttur. Bunlar arasında yerel bağlantı, uzak bağlantı, SSH veya GUI kullanarak yerel bağlantı yer alır.
Yerel bağlantı, aynı sunucuda çalışan programlar arasında bağlantı kurmaktır. Bunun için MySQL sunucusu ve MySQL terminali aynı bilgisayarda olması gerekiyor. Uzak bağlantı ise aynı ağ üzerindeki bir sunucuya bağlanmak için kullanılan bir yöntemdir.
SSH kullanarak yerel bağlantı ise, daha güvenli bir bağlantı yöntemidir. SSH ile, bağlantı kurmak istediğiniz sunucuya öncelikle SSH bağlantısı kurmanız gerekiyor. Bu bağlantı kurulduktan sonra, MySQL sunucusuna bağlanabilirsiniz.
GUI kullanarak yerel bağlantı ise, MySQL sunucusuna grafik arayüzü üzerinden bağlanma yöntemidir. Bu yöntem, daha az teknik bilgiye sahip olan kullanıcılar için daha kullanışlıdır.
Bu adımları takip ederek MySQL sunucusuna bağlanabilir ve veritabanı oluşturma işlemine devam edebilirsiniz.
Adım 2.1: MySQL Sunucusuna Yerel Bağlantı
MySQL sunucuna yerel bağlantı kurarak, veritabanınızdaki verilerinizi kolaylıkla yönetebilirsiniz. MySQL sunucuya yerel olarak bağlanmak için birkaç yöntem bulunmaktadır.
İlk yöntem, MySQL sunucusuna terminal kullanarak yerel olarak bağlanmaktır. Bunun için, MySQL sunucusunda çalışan terminali açmanız gerekir. Ardından, MySQL sunucuya bağlanmak için kullandığınız kullanıcı adı ve şifrenizi girmelisiniz. Bu yöntem ile sunucuda direkt olarak herhangi bir değişiklik yapabilirsiniz.
Diğer bir yöntem ise, MySQL sunucusuna GUI (Grafiksel Kullanıcı Arayüzü) kullanarak yerel olarak bağlanmaktır. Bu yöntem kullanıcı dostu bir arayüz sağlar ve herhangi bir programlama dili veya becerisi gerektirmez. Çoğu web hosting firmaları, kullanıcıların admin panelinde yerel erişim için bir seçenek sağlar.
Son olarak, MySQL sunucusuna yerel olarak bağlanmak için SSH (Güvenli Kabuk) kullanabilirsiniz. SSH kullanarak, yerel cihazınızla sunucu arasında şifreli ve güvenli bir bağlantı kurabilirsiniz. Bu yöntem sıklıkla uzak sunuculara yapılan erişimlerde kullanılır.
Yukarıdaki yöntemlerden birini seçerek MySQL sunucuya yerel olarak bağlanabilirsiniz. Daha sonra veritabanı oluşturma veya mevcut veritabanınızda değişiklik yapma işlemlerini gerçekleştirebilirsiniz.
Adım 2.1.1: MySQL Sunucusuna SSH İle Yerel Bağlantı
MySQL sunucusuna SSH kullanarak yerel bağlantı kurmak için öncelikle bir SSH istemcisi yüklenmesi gerekmektedir. Bu adımın tamamlanması ile birlikte aşağıdaki adımları izleyerek bağlantı kurabilirsiniz.
Adım | Açıklama |
---|---|
1 | SSH istemcisini açın ve "ssh kullanıcıadı@sunucuipadresi" komutunu girin. |
2 | Sunucudaki yönetici parolasını girdikten sonra SSH ile sunucuya erişim sağlanmış olur. |
3 | Başarıyla SSH ile sunucuya eriştiğinizden emin olduktan sonra "mysql -u kullanıcıadı -p" komutunu girerek MySQL sunucusuna bağlanın. |
4 | Şimdi MySQL sunucusu parolasını girdikten sonra veritabanlarına erişim sağlanabilirsiniz. |
5 | Veritabanını kullanmak için "use veritabanıismi" komutunu kullanın. |
SSH ile yerel bağlantı oldukça güvenli bir yöntemdir ve birçok geliştirici tarafından kullanılmaktadır. Bu yöntem ile bağlantı kurabilmek için kullanıcı adı ve parola gibi bilgilere ihtiyacınız olacaktır. Bu bilgileri almadan önce güvendiğiniz bir kaynaktan edinmeniz, güvenliğiniz açısından önemlidir.
Adım 2.1.2: MySQL Sunucusuna GUI İle Yerel Bağlantı
MySQL veritabanı oluşturmanın bir adımı da GUI kullanarak yerel bağlantı kurmaktır. Bu işlem için ilk olarak bir GUI programı indirilmesi gerekmektedir. Bunun için tercih edilebilecek bazı popüler programlar arasında HeidiSQL, Navicat for MySQL, ve dbForge Studio gibi araçlar yer almaktadır.
Genellikle kurulum sihirbazı tarafından yönlendirileceğiniz için, programın yüklenmesi genellikle kolaydır. Kurulum tamamlandıktan sonra, programı açın ve sunucu adını ve kullanıcı adını girin. Eğer yerel bir sunucuya bağlanıyorsanız, genellikle kullanıcı adına "root" yazmanız yeterli olacaktır.
Bağlantı kurmak için gerekli olan bilgileri girdikten sonra, bağlantı açma tuşuna basarak işlemi tamamlayabilirsiniz. Artık MySQL veritabanı sunucusuna GUI üzerinden bağlanabilir ve istediğiniz işlemleri yapabilirsiniz.
Bu adımda dikkat edilmesi gereken birkaç nokta bulunmaktadır. Öncelikle, kullanıcı adı ve şifrenin veritabanı sunucusunda tanımlanmış olması gerekmektedir. Ayrıca, bazı durumlarda MySQL sunucusu yerel ağınızın dışında bir yerde bulunabilir, bu durumlarda uzak bağlantı kurmak gerekebilir.
MySQL sunucusuna GUI kullanarak yerel bağlantı kurma adımlarının oldukça kolay olduğu söylenebilir. Ancak, dikkat edilmesi gereken bazı noktalar olduğu için, doğru çalışması için gerekli olan bilgilerin doğru şekilde girildiğinden emin olunmalıdır.
Adım 2.2: MySQL Sunucusuna Uzak Bağlantı
MySQL veritabanı oluşturma adımları arasında, MySQL sunucusuna uzaktan bağlanma da yer alır. Bu işlem, sunucunun bulunduğu yerden farklı bir yerden erişmek istediğinizde kullanılır. Bu sayede veritabanı yönetim işlemlerini herhangi bir yerden gerçekleştirebilirsiniz.
MySQL sunucusuna uzaktan erişim yapabilmek için, öncelikle internet bağlantınızın olması gereklidir. Sunucunuz internete açık ve 3306 port numarasını kullanarak gelen bağlantılara izin veriyorsa, uzaktan bağlantı gerçekleştirebilirsiniz.
Bunun için, öncelikle sunucu yönetim paneline giriş yapın. Ardından, sunucuda çalışan MySQL veritabanı sunucusuna bağlanmak için uzak erişim izni vermeniz gerekmektedir. Bunun için, sunucunuzun yanı sıra, doğru kullanıcı adı ve şifre ile birlikte veritabanınızı oluşturduğunuzda kullanılan IP adresini de eklemeniz gerekmektedir.
Uzak bağlantıya izin vermek için, ayrıca MySQL sunucusu yapılandırma dosyasını da düzenlemeniz gerekebilir. Bu dosya genellikle "my.cnf" olarak adlandırılır ve sunucunuzun işletim sistemine göre farklı bir konumda yer alabilir. Dosyayı açarak, "bind-address" satırındaki IP adresi kısmını, "0.0.0.0" olarak değiştirebilirsiniz.
Uzaktan bağlanmak için, MySQL sunucusu IP adresini ya da alan adını girip, 3306 numaralı portu kullanarak bağlantı gerçekleştirebilirsiniz. Bunun için, herhangi bir MySQL istemcisi kullanabilirsiniz. İstemci programına sunucu IP adresi, kullanıcı adı ve şifre bilgilerinizi girerek bağlantı yapabilirsiniz. Böylece, sunucunuzdaki veritabanlarını kontrol edebilir ve yönetebilirsiniz.
Adım 3: Veritabanı Oluşturma
Bir veritabanı oluşturmadan önce, öncelikle MySQL sunucusuna bağlı olduğunuzdan emin olun. Adım 2'de sunucuya başarıyla bağlandıysanız, şimdi veritabanı oluşturma adımlarına geçebilirsiniz.
Bir veritabanı oluşturmak için iki farklı yöntem vardır. Bunlardan ilki, MySQL terminal kullanarak veritabanını elle oluşturmaktır. İkincisi ise PhpMyAdmin gibi bir web tabanlı arayüz kullanarak veritabanı oluşturmaktır.
MySQL terminali kullanarak veritabanı oluşturmak oldukça basittir. Aşağıdaki adımları izleyin:
- MySQL sunucusuna bağlanın.
- CREATE DATABASE komutunu kullanarak yeni bir veritabanı oluşturun.
- USE komutunu kullanarak yeni oluşturduğunuz veritabanına geçiş yapın.
Örnek bir veritabanı oluşturma komutunu aşağıda görebilirsiniz:
CREATE DATABASE veritabani_adi;
Böylece, yeni bir veritabanı oluşturmuş oldunuz.
PhpMyAdmin kullanarak veritabanı oluşturmak daha görsel bir yöntemdir. Adımları aşağıdaki gibidir:
- PhpMyAdmin'e giriş yapın ve sol taraftaki menüden "Veritabanları"na tıklayın.
- "Yeni" butonuna tıklayın.
- Açılacak sayfada, "Yeni Veritabanı Oluştur" başlığını göreceksiniz.
- "Veritabanı Adı" kısmına bir ad girin ve "Oluştur" butonuna tıklayın.
Bu adımları tamamladıktan sonra, yeni bir veritabanı oluşturmuş olursunuz.
Bu adımları takip ederek, başarıyla bir MySQL veritabanı oluşturabilirsiniz.
Adım 3.1: MySQL Terminal Üzerinden Veritabanı Oluşturma
MySQL terminal kullanarak veritabanı oluşturma oldukça basittir. Öncelikle, terminali açın ve MySQL sunucusuna bağlanın. Bağlantı sağlandığında, aşağıdaki adımları takip edin:
- Veritabanı oluşturmak için "CREATE DATABASE" komutunu kullanın.
- Veritabanı adını belirtin. Örneğin, "CREATE DATABASE örnek_veritabanı;"
- Veritabanını kontrol edin. "SHOW DATABASES;" komutunu kullanarak oluşturduğunuz veritabanının listesini görüntüleyebilirsiniz.
Veritabanınızı başarılı bir şekilde oluşturduysanız, artık tablo oluşturmaya hazırsınız. Tablo oluşturmak için aşağıdaki adımları takip edin:
- Öncelikle, kullanacağınız veritabanını seçin. "USE örnek_veritabanı;" komutunu kullanabilirsiniz.
- Tablo oluşturmak için "CREATE TABLE" komutunu kullanın. Tablonun adını ve sütunları belirtmeniz gerekiyor. Örneğin, "CREATE TABLE örnek_tablo (id INT, adı VARCHAR (255), soyadı VARCHAR (255));" komutunu kullanabilirsiniz.
- Bir sonraki adım, tablo yapısını kontrol etmektir. "DESCRIBE örnek_tablo;" komutunu kullanarak tablo sütunlarını görüntüleyebilirsiniz.
- Bir sonraki adım, tabloya veri eklemektir. "INSERT INTO örnek_tablo (id, adı, soyadı) VALUES (1, 'Örnek', 'Kişi');" komutunu kullanarak tabloya veri ekleyebilirsiniz.
- Bir sonraki adım, tablodaki verileri görüntülemektir. "SELECT * FROM örnek_tablo;" komutunu kullanarak tablodaki tüm verileri görüntüleyebilirsiniz.
MySQL terminal kullanarak veritabanı ve tablo oluşturma oldukça basittir. Adımları doğru bir şekilde izlerseniz, hızlı bir şekilde veritabanlarını oluşturabilir ve yönetebilirsiniz.
Adım 3.2: PhpMyAdmin Üzerinden Veritabanı Oluşturma
PhpMyAdmin, veritabanı yönetimini kolaylaştıran bir arayüz sunar. Bu arayüz, kullanıcıların veritabanı oluşturmasına, güncellemesine, sorgulamasına ve silmesine olanak tanır. PhpMyAdmin üzerinden veritabanı oluşturma adımlarını takip ederek veritabanınızı oluşturabilirsiniz.
İlk olarak, PhpMyAdmin panelinize giriş yapın. Ardından, sol taraftaki menüde "Veritabanları"na tıklayın ve "Yeni" düğmesine basın.
Bir sonraki ekranda, veritabanınıza bir isim verin ve karater seti seçin. Veritabanınızın karakter seti, veritabanı içeriği için önemlidir. Karakter setini seçtikten sonra "Oluştur" düğmesine tıklayarak yeni veritabanınızı oluşturabilirsiniz.
PhpMyAdmin, yeni veritabanınızın oluşturulduğuna dair bir onay mesajı gösterecektir. Artık yeni veritabanınızda çalışmaya başlayabilir ya da var olan verilerinizi içeri aktararak veritabanınızı güncelleyebilirsiniz.
PhpMyAdmin, veritabanı yönetimi için güçlü bir araçtır. Veritabanı oluşturmak ve yönetmek için kullanımı kolay bir arayüz sunar. PhpMyAdmin üzerinden veritabanınızı oluşturabilir ve gereksinimlerinize uygun hale getirebilirsiniz.